SLD69400 - 400Amp Circuit Breaker
The Siemens SLD69400 is a top-tier low voltage Sentron molded case circuit breaker designed to ensure superior protection and operational reliability for your electrical systems. This high-performance circuit breaker features an advanced electronic trip unit (ETU) within a robust LD frame, providing precise and programmable protection settings. Engineered to meet the stringent UL 489 and IEC 60947-2 standards, the SLD69400 offers a rated current of 400A and operates with a 3-pole configuration, delivering an impressive breaking capacity of 25kAIC at 600V and 35kAIC at 480V. Technical Specifications:
- Rated Current: 400A
- Number of Poles: 3
- Breaking Capacity: 25kAIC at 600V, 35kAIC at 480V
- Dimensions: 7.5 inches (W) x 11 inches (H) x 4 inches (D)
- Wire Range: 3/0AWG - 500KCM (CU) / 4/0AWG - 500KCM (AL)
- Special Features: Line and load side lugs (TA2J6500)
